隨著近些年,web前端開發行業薪資的水漲船高,越來越多的人選擇加入到前端開發行業,他們中的絕大多數人都沒有任何編程基礎,對於這些零基礎的人要怎麼學習web前端開發呢?前端開發都要學習哪些知識。零基礎小白轉行如何入門學習web前端 首先你要知道什麼是web前端,web前端是做什麼的。Web前端做的工作 ...
隨著近些年,web前端開發行業薪資的水漲船高,越來越多的人選擇加入到前端開發行業,他們中的絕大多數人都沒有任何編程基礎,對於這些零基礎的人要怎麼學習web前端開發呢?前端開發都要學習哪些知識。零基礎小白轉行如何入門學習web前端
首先你要知道什麼是web前端,web前端是做什麼的。Web前端做的工作主要是製作網頁,將網站的界面更好的展現給用戶,併在原有的靜態頁面上增加動態效果,那麼web前端都包括什麼內容需要我們學習呢?主要需要學習的技術是:html、css、JavaScript,這是你想成為前端工程師必須要掌握的三個方面。
由於是零基礎的學習web前端,所以在學習的過程中可能會有一點兒難度,大家可以找一個靠譜的學習路線有計劃的學習,好的學習計劃加上良好的執行力可以讓我們有事半功倍的效果。小編建議大家可以按照以下學習順序:
1、前端頁面重構。主要內容為PC端網站佈局、HTML5+CSS3基礎、WebApp頁面佈局。學習目標是完成PC端網站佈局,WebApp頁面佈局,還要可以通過HTML5+CSS3的2D、3D等屬性實現一些精美的動畫效果。
2、JavaScript高級課程、PC端全棧項目開發。主要內容為原生JavaScript、面向對象進階與ES5/ES6應用、JavaScript工具庫自主研發、JQuery經典交互特效開發、HTTP協議、Ajax進階與後端開發、前端工程化與模塊化應用以及AngularJS等。學習目標是可以通過原生JavaScript開發交互功能,實現網站上的交互效果,以及模塊化應用等,實現完整的前端工程。
3、Web前端框架、混合開發(Hybrid,RN)、大數據可視化。主要內容為Node.js後端開發、Vue.js前端框架、React前端框架、混合開發(Hybrid,RN)、Angular前端框架、大數據可視化等。學習目標是可以獨立完成相應的項目,如微信場景,應用Vue.js/Ionic/React.js等框架開發WebApp,微信小程式項目開發,以及各類混合應用項目開發等。
IT小白可以按照以上的學習路線來學習web前端,歡迎大家在評論區評論留言
小編也在前端混了有幾年,整理了一些學習資料,對web開發技術感興趣的同學
歡迎加入新建的Q群:603985993,不管你是小白還是大牛我都歡迎,希望大家誠心交流!
還有大牛整理的一套高效率學習路線和教程與您免費分享,與企業需求同步。
好友都在裡面學習交流,每天都會有大牛定時講解前端技術!